A month and a week ago, I tried out ceramic painting with friends in a new store in town.
I already had an idea of what I wanted to do but the D-day, I became overwhelmed with stress: I spent an entire hour hesitating before the wide range of crockery and my project appeared very ambitious 😭
As a result, I rushed my project during the last session hour left: I simplified the original pattern and engraved it with a bevelled stick onto the layers of paints.
We picked up our creations last wednesday.

I was sceptical with what I left but the final result left me speechless! 😯
Ceramic painting is hard because it's difficult to look ahead for the final appearance of your product. The shop owners explained that the true colors reveal themselves after the coating processes and all blank spaces become dazzling white.
I'm surprinsingly satisfied with how it turns. The deep dark blue was closed to what I was expected (the paints are miscible) and the pattern is clearly visible! It's a kind of magic somehow! 😯
